Swingarm Choices
It seems like an upgraded swingarm is on most grom clone owners’ wish list. There are a bunch of options out there. I’ve pretty much decided on a Kepspeed swingarm, mainly because of the needle bearings at the pivot point.
Here are my questions: One model has an additional brace. Is it structurally necessary or is it just eye candy and added weight? Kepspeed offers two lengths: stock and 6cm longer. Is there any advantage to 6cm added length? I know that when you add length, it helps with launch, but you add to the turning radius. I know, I’m adding a precision swingarm to a not so precise frame, but it is what it is. Tell me what your thoughts are! Enjoy the Ride!
